Companies

This commit is contained in:
Eden Kirin
2023-08-27 11:22:45 +02:00
parent 9700ff2607
commit 3c15f189f6
3 changed files with 119 additions and 1 deletions

View File

@ -1,7 +1,10 @@
from litestar import Router
from app.controllers.company import CompanyController
from app.controllers.fiscal_payment_mapping import FiscalPaymentMappingController
from app.controllers.machine import MachineController
from app.domain.company import Company
from app.domain.fiscal_payment_mapping import FiscalPaymentMapping
from app.domain.machine import Machine
__all__ = ["create_router"]
@ -11,11 +14,13 @@ def create_router() -> Router:
return Router(
path="/v1",
route_handlers=[
CompanyController,
MachineController,
FiscalPaymentMappingController,
],
signature_namespace={
"Company": Company,
"Machine": Machine,
"FiscalPaymentMappingController": FiscalPaymentMappingController,
"FiscalPaymentMapping": FiscalPaymentMapping,
},
)